一、update标签 MyBatis update 标签用于定义更新语句,执行更新操作。当 MyBatis 执行完一条更新语句后,会返回一个整数,表示受影响的数据库记录的行数。 如以下xml文件中的语句 update 标签常用属性 注意:update 标签中 ...
mysql语句如下: mybatis的mapper如下: mybatis的mapper.xml文件如下: ...
2016-09-24 13:50 0 1594 推荐指数:
一、update标签 MyBatis update 标签用于定义更新语句,执行更新操作。当 MyBatis 执行完一条更新语句后,会返回一个整数,表示受影响的数据库记录的行数。 如以下xml文件中的语句 update 标签常用属性 注意:update 标签中 ...
当你传入所需要修改的值为一个实体对象时,可能只改动了其中部分的值。那么其他值需要做一个判断是否为空值的操作。 XXXmapper.xml <update id="updateMember" parameterType="com.zbh.entity.Member"> ...
更新单条记录 更新多条记录的同一个字段为同一个值 更新多条记录为多个字段为不同的值比较普通的写法,是通过循环,依次执行update语句。Mybatis写法如下: 一条记录update一次,性能比较差,容易造成阻塞。PostgreSQL没有提供直接的方法来实现批量更新,但可以 ...
下边看一下mybatis的映射文件。 <insert id="AddTeacher" parameterType="com.mycompany.entity.Teacher"> <selectKey keyProperty="count" resultType="int ...
批量插入: Mapper文件中的写法 这样写总是报错,调试了很长时间也没找到问题原因 最后找到这里http://my.oschina.net/jsonavaj/blo ...
1. 动态update UPDATE ui.user_question_section_xref <set> reviewer = #{0}, score = #{1} , last_update_user = #{0}, <if test ...
方法有三种:1.通过java代码batch方式,xml文件只需一条update语句。java代码繁琐 2.xml使用foreach,“;”分割多条update语句,要求:jdbc的url需加上allowMultiQueries=true。速度慢 3.xml使用foreach进行代码拼接,用了 ...